Interop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Attention
The WF3 Types are deprecated. Instead, please use the new WF4 Types from System.Activities.*
Activité qui gère l’exécution d’un Activity flux de travail.
public ref class Interop sealed : System::Activities::NativeActivity, System::ComponentModel::ICustomTypeDescriptor
public sealed class Interop : System.Activities.NativeActivity, System.ComponentModel.ICustomTypeDescriptor
[System.Obsolete("The WF3 Types are deprecated. Instead, please use the new WF4 Types from System.Activities.*")]
public sealed class Interop : System.Activities.NativeActivity, System.ComponentModel.ICustomTypeDescriptor
type Interop = class
inherit NativeActivity
interface ICustomTypeDescriptor
[<System.Obsolete("The WF3 Types are deprecated. Instead, please use the new WF4 Types from System.Activities.*")>]
type Interop = class
inherit NativeActivity
interface ICustomTypeDescriptor
Public NotInheritable Class Interop
Inherits NativeActivity
Implements ICustomTypeDescriptor
- Héritage
- Attributs
- Implémente
Remarques
Note
L’activité Interop n’apparaît pas dans la boîte à outils du concepteur de flux de travail, sauf si le projet du flux de travail a son Target Framework paramètre défini .Net Framework 4sur .
Avertissement
En raison de limitations dans les types d’interface que l’activité Interop peut prendre en charge et HandleExternalEventActivityCallExternalMethodActivity ne peut pas être utilisée directement, mais les activités dérivées créées à l’aide de l’outil Activité de communication de flux de travail (WCA.exe) peuvent être utilisées.
Constructeurs
| Nom | Description |
|---|---|
| Interop() |
Obsolète.
Crée une instance de la Interop classe. |
Propriétés
| Nom | Description |
|---|---|
| ActivityMetaProperties |
Obsolète.
Collection de paires nom-valeur qui correspond aux métadonnées de la Activitypropriété d’une Name activité ou de la propriété d’une WhileActivityCondition activité. |
| ActivityProperties |
Obsolète.
Obtient la collection de paires nom-valeur qui correspond aux propriétés d’entrée et de sortie du Activity. |
| ActivityType |
Obsolète.
Obtient ou définit le type de l’activité contenue dans l’activité Interop . |
| CacheId |
Obsolète.
Obtient l’identificateur du cache unique dans l’étendue de la définition de workflow. (Hérité de Activity) |
| CanInduceIdle |
Obsolète.
Obtient ou définit une valeur qui indique si l’activité peut entraîner l’inactivité du flux de travail. (Hérité de NativeActivity) |
| Constraints |
Obsolète.
Obtient une collection d’activités Constraint qui peuvent être configurées pour fournir la validation pour le Activity. (Hérité de Activity) |
| DisplayName |
Obsolète.
Obtient ou définit un nom convivial facultatif utilisé pour le débogage, la validation, la gestion des exceptions et le suivi. (Hérité de Activity) |
| Id |
Obsolète.
Obtient un identificateur unique dans l’étendue de la définition de flux de travail. (Hérité de Activity) |
| Implementation |
Obsolète.
Logique d’exécution de l’activité. (Hérité de NativeActivity) |
| ImplementationVersion |
Obsolète.
Obtient ou définit la version d’implémentation de l’activité. (Hérité de NativeActivity) |
Méthodes
| Nom | Description |
|---|---|
| Abort(NativeActivityAbortContext) |
Obsolète.
En cas d’implémentation dans une classe dérivée, effectue des actions en réponse à l’activité abandonnée. (Hérité de NativeActivity) |
| CacheMetadata(ActivityMetadata) |
Obsolète.
Non implémenté. Utilisez plutôt la CacheMetadata(NativeActivityMetadata) méthode. (Hérité de NativeActivity) |
| CacheMetadata(NativeActivityMetadata) |
Obsolète.
Crée et valide une description des arguments, variables, activités enfants et délégués d’activité de l’activité de l’activité. (Hérité de NativeActivity) |
| Cancel(NativeActivityContext) |
Obsolète.
En cas d’implémentation dans une classe dérivée, exécute la logique pour provoquer l’achèvement précoce de l’activité. (Hérité de NativeActivity) |
| Equals(Object) |
Obsolète.
Détermine si l’objet spécifié est égal à l’objet actuel. (Hérité de Object) |
| Execute(NativeActivityContext) |
Obsolète.
En cas d’implémentation dans une classe dérivée, exécute la logique d’exécution de l’activité. (Hérité de NativeActivity) |
| GetHashCode() |
Obsolète.
Sert de fonction de hachage par défaut. (Hérité de Object) |
| GetType() |
Obsolète.
Obtient la Type de l’instance actuelle. (Hérité de Object) |
| MemberwiseClone() |
Obsolète.
Crée une copie superficielle du Objectactuel. (Hérité de Object) |
| OnCreateDynamicUpdateMap(NativeActivityUpdateMapMetadata, Activity) |
Obsolète.
Déclenche un événement lors de la création d’une carte pour la mise à jour dynamique. (Hérité de NativeActivity) |
| OnCreateDynamicUpdateMap(UpdateMapMetadata, Activity) |
Obsolète.
Déclenche un événement lors de la création d’une carte pour la mise à jour dynamique. (Hérité de NativeActivity) |
| ShouldSerializeDisplayName() |
Obsolète.
Indique si la DisplayName propriété doit être sérialisée. (Hérité de Activity) |
| ToString() |
Obsolète.
Retourne un String qui contient le Id et DisplayName le Activity. (Hérité de Activity) |
| UpdateInstance(NativeActivityUpdateContext) |
Obsolète.
Met à jour l’instance de NativeActivity. (Hérité de NativeActivity) |
Implémentations d’interfaces explicites
| Nom | Description |
|---|---|
| ICustomTypeDescriptor.GetAttributes() |
Obsolète.
Retourne la collection d’attributs pour le contenu Activity. |
| ICustomTypeDescriptor.GetClassName() |
Obsolète.
Retourne le nom de la classe du contenu Activity. |
| ICustomTypeDescriptor.GetComponentName() |
Obsolète.
Retourne le nom du contenu Activity. |
| ICustomTypeDescriptor.GetConverter() |
Obsolète.
Retourne le convertisseur de type associé pour le contenu Activity. |
| ICustomTypeDescriptor.GetDefaultEvent() |
Obsolète.
Retourne l’événement par défaut pour le contenu Activity. |
| ICustomTypeDescriptor.GetDefaultProperty() |
Obsolète.
Retourne la propriété par défaut pour le contenu Activity. |
| ICustomTypeDescriptor.GetEditor(Type) |
Obsolète.
Retourne l’éditeur pour le contenu Activity. |
| ICustomTypeDescriptor.GetEvents() |
Obsolète.
Retourne la collection d’événements pour le contenu Activity. |
| ICustomTypeDescriptor.GetEvents(Attribute[]) |
Obsolète.
Retourne la collection d’événements pour le contenu à Activity l’aide du tableau d’attributs spécifié en tant que filtre. |
| ICustomTypeDescriptor.GetProperties() |
Obsolète.
Retourne la collection de propriétés pour le contenu Activity. |
| ICustomTypeDescriptor.GetProperties(Attribute[]) |
Obsolète.
Retourne la collection de propriétés pour le contenu Activity à l’aide d’un tableau d’attributs spécifié en tant que filtre. |
| ICustomTypeDescriptor.GetPropertyOwner(PropertyDescriptor) |
Obsolète.
Retourne le propriétaire du descripteur de propriété spécifié ou l’activité Interop elle-même si le descripteur de propriété n’a pas de propriétaire. |